To reliably determine what type of DCE file you’re dealing with, your best move is to collect several strong hints that help you identify its real format without relying solely on the extension; first consider where it came from, because files produced by export tools, backup folders, or business systems are usually meant to be reopened within that same software, while files that arrive as unexpected downloads or email attachments are often renamed or intentionally protected. Next, open the file in Notepad to check whether it displays readable XML or JSON, which normally means it’s a data export and may even include version or creator details, versus mostly unreadable characters that point to a compressed or encrypted binary. The strongest indicator is its header or “magic number,” since many DCE files turn out to be everyday formats: ZIP often shows a PK header, PDF begins with %PDF-, JPEG starts with FFD8FF, and PNG with 89504E47; if you see one of those, renaming a copy usually lets it open. Windows Properties may reveal which app registered `.dce`, though overlapping claims can muddy the waters. Lastly, check the file’s size and location: tiny files tend to be stubs or half-finished downloads, while larger files in export folders usually act as containers; combining all clues tells you whether it’s a mislabeled common file, a readable text export, or a proprietary package that needs its original app.
Since “the .dce format” isn’t a single, unified standard like PDF or MP4, various tools and products have assigned their own meanings to `.dce`, with the most common modern usage referring to Lytx DriveCam event recordings exported from DriveCam/SF-Series/SV2 devices for viewing in Lytx Event Player instead of typical media players; file-identification references even mention repeated byte patterns such as a STRT header, reinforcing that the structure is defined by the parent software. Less common usages include Autodesk/AutoCAD dialog error logs and settings/data files from niche applications, which explains the mixed answers you’ll see online. Ultimately, a DCE file’s actual format is best determined by its origin and, if necessary, by examining its signature, since two `.dce` files may have nothing in common beyond the extension.

What you do next depends on what your checks reveal, because a DCE file can behave like anything from a mislabeled everyday document to a locked container; if the header shows it’s really a standard format—ZIP with PK bytes, PDF with “%PDF”, or an image like JPG/PNG—then just duplicate the file, rename the copy to the right extension, and open it normally using tools like 7-Zip, WinRAR, a PDF reader, or your photo viewer. If a Notepad peek reveals readable XML/JSON or words such as “metadata”, treat it as a data export: look for product or creator names and re-import it into the original software or use tools compatible with its format. But if the content is unreadable binary and the header doesn’t match any common file type, it’s probably compressed, encoded, encrypted, or app-specific, meaning only the correct software can open or restore it. If Windows lists a default “Opens with,” try that program carefully, since it may have created the file. And if the DCE appeared after a shady download or suspicious activity, consider it untrusted: avoid double-clicking, run a malware scan, and put safety first.
